Shortcuts/ Menues of InDesign CS5.5 do not work anymore

Hy folks!

I run CS5.5 premium under Win 7 ultimate on a Lenovo P50 workstation with an 4K monitor.

After successfully installing CS 5.5 InDesign worked a few day properly, but then I could not activate the icons at the left side with mouse (only via keyboard combinations) and the menues on top of the window can not been activated anymore, neither with mouse nor keyboard.

The same programm I installed for test on a Lenovo T400 with Win 7 professional and here it works without any problems for weeks.

Internet suggest delete cache and preferences in C:/user/app data/roaming... and .../local... but problem continues ;-(

After re-installing programm same result: some days working, then as descripted.

Any idea how to get InDesign working propperly again?

Do it "factory reset" - There is a quick and easy method for doing this using the keyboard: close and relaunch InDesign, and IMMEDIATELY hold down Ctrl + Alt + Shift (Windows) or Cmd + Ctrl + Opt + Shift (Mac), and respond in the affirmative to the dialog asking if you really want to replace the preferences.

Troubleshooting 101: Replace, or "trash" your InDesign preferences
